Ty Prototype Black and ORANGE Original Dark Stripes cat

This is the very neat counterpart/later stage prototype to the solid black stripes prototype with patch! Dark Stripes Stripes was the original 3rd generation version of Stripes the cat – later released with a lighter gold fabric. Royal Blue Bessie Ty Prototype Cow

This is one of our all-time favorite prototypes! This Bessie is a full alternate ROYAL BLUE fabric color – the same color fabric used for the royal blue peanut – full departure for this original 3rd generation cow. Complete with pax tags.
